Features

Core Complex

  • Single and dual e5500 cores, built on Power Architecture technology
  • Up to 1.4 GHz with 64-bit ISA support
  • Three levels of instructions: user, supervisor, hypervisor
  • Hybrid 32-bit mode to support legacy software and transition to a 64-bit architecture
  • 256 KB backside L2 cache

Networking Elements

  • SerDes
    • Four lanes at up to 10 Gbps
    • Supports SGMII, QSGMII, PCIe and SATA
  • Ethernet Interfaces
    • 1x 10GbE and 3x 1GbE or 4x 1Gbe Gigabit Ethernet interfaces, with MACsec on all ports

Accelerators and Memory Control

  • 32/64-bit DDR3L/4 SDRAM memory controller with ECC support
    • Up to 1600 MT/s
  • DPAA incorporating acceleration for the following functions: packet parsing, classification and distribution
    • Queue management for scheduling, packet sequencing and congestion management
    • Hardware buffer management for buffer allocation and de-allocation
    • Integrated security acceleration (SEC)

Basic Peripherals and Interconnect

  • CoreNet® platform cache
    • 256 KB shared platform cache
  • Hierarchical interconnect fabric
    • CoreNet fabric supporting coherent and non-coherent transactions with prioritization and bandwidth allocation amongst CoreNet endpoints
  • Additional peripheral interfaces one Serial ATA (SATA 2.0) controllers
    • Two high-speed USB 2.0 controllers with integrated PHYs
    • Enhanced secure digital host controller (SD/MMC/eMMC)
    • Enhanced serial peripheral interface (eSPI)
    • Two I²C controllers
    • Four UARTS
    • Integrated flash controller supporting NAND and NOR flash
  • DMA
    • Dual four channel
    • Up to 4.1 Gbps Ethernet MACs as part of DPAA
  • QUICC Engine®
    • Support for legacy protocols TDM, HDLC, UART and ISDN
  • High-speed peripheral interfaces
    • Three PCI Express® 2.0 controllers

Additional Features

  • Support for hardware virtualization and partitioning enforcement
    • Extra privileged level for hypervisor support
  • QorIQ® trust architecture
    • Secure boot, secure debug, tamper detection, volatile key storage
